Q: Is 130,475,233 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 130,475,233 is a composite number.

Why is 130,475,233 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 130,475,233 can be evenly divided by 1 7 18,639,319 and 130,475,233, with no remainder.

Since 130,475,233 cannot be divided by just 1 and 130,475,233, it is a composite number.
